Greetings!

Since my last newsletter I reunited with Al Stewart and played a show with him in Laughlin Nevada. When I started my professional career in the 70s, it was with his band, and It was fun to play the old songs and enjoy his sense of humor again! The following week I flew to Philadelphia to play at Penn's Landing, a free show put on by the city of Philadelphia. Euge Groove and Richard Elliot and I playing in the open air in a show we call Jazz Attack. A lovely warm evening- perfect for an outdoor show.

Soon after, I had my first visit to Muskegon, Michigan performing a show with Euge Groove at the 2nd annual Shoreline Jazz Festival. Thanks to musician, broadcaster and all-around good guy Alexander Zonjic for always coming up with new venues and putting on this great event! The next week, it was Copper Mountain, Colorado for the Genuine Wine and Jazz Festival. It was nice to see so many fellow musicians- Brian Simpson, Paul Taylor, Kim Waters, Nick Colionne and Marc Antoine and perform in this wonderful scenic spot in the mountains.

Apart from a very brief appearance in Cabo Wabo during the Smooth Jazz Cruise in 2006, I have not played south of the border, so it was great to finally do my first ever full-length show in Mexico at the 1st annual Cancun Smooth Jazz Festival. I met some wonderful people there including a family of smooth jazz fans from Mexico City who were thrilled to see a smooth jazz concert in their country. The festival was held at the Hard Rock Resort, just South of Cancun where even the drinks were on the house as part of the admission fee! So many friends there- Rick Braun, Dave Koz, Euge Groove, Keiko Matsui, Paul Taylor, Elan Trotman, Tim Bowman, Nick Colionne, Kenny Lattimore, Boney James, Brian Culbertson and many more. I'm scheduled again for next year- looking forward to it!

The Hyatt Regency Newport Beach- I've been playing at this venue now for 20 years and it's always a joy. A Jazz Attack show with Euge Groove and Richard Elliot under the twinkling stars - what could be better! We had the pleasure of playing there just last weekend and had a blast, and then the very next day I reunited with my buddies Michael Paulo, Gregg Karukas, Nate Phillips and Eric Valentine to play a 2-hour PW show at the Aliante Casino and Resort in North Las Vegas which included selections from my entire musical history- I even played a song I wrote with Al Stewart in 1978, "Time Passages". We also played new releases from both Gregg and Michael and the show included some solo guitar pieces so as to give the band a break. We ended with Michael Paulo's version of the hit song "Happy".

In my down time I've been working on putting together a live album of my Christmas show with Mindi Abair and Rick Braun- more about that soon! Also, in between all these activities I found time to see some of my favourite classic bands at the Los Angeles County Fair- Kool & The Gang, The Ohio Players, ZZ Top, Chicago and Boz Skaggs- I had a wonderful time watching these great shows as an audience member. Now I have a few days off but there are a lot of shows coming up soon including England in November and then my Christmas tour.

I'll see you all out there!

Promenade to Jakarta
Peter White and Michael Paulo at Java Jazz Festival

Established in 2005, the Java Jazz Festival in Jakarta, Indonesia is one of the largest and most prestigious festivals in the world. The first festival was attended by 47,500 visitors during its three-day stretch and has grown every year since.

Peter performed at Java Jazz Festival in 2006. Below is a video clip from that show playing "Promenade", one of Peter's most recognizable and popular songs.
Where did Peter get his inspiration for it? The idea came to him in 1992 while in a taxi cab in London traveling from the airport to his brother Danny's house. 

With Michael Paulo (sax), Kimo Cornwell (keys), Smitty Smith (bass), Ray Fuller (gtr), Sergio Gonzalez (drums) and Lenny Castro (perc).
